1906/00/00 Albert O Clarke Architect Featuring a Greco-Roman Temple facade, Benton County National Bank is built in the Classical Revival style.

PLACE DETAILS
Registry Name: Benton County National Bank
Registry Address: 123 W. Central
Registry Number: 83001156
Resource Type: Building
Owner: Local
Architect: Clark,Albert Oscar
Architectural Style: Classical revival
Contributing Buildings: 1
Certification: Listed in the National Register
CULTURAL DETAILS
Level of Significance: Local
Area of Significance: Commerce, Architecture, Politics-government
Applicable Criteria: Architecture-Engineering
Period of Significance: 1900-1924
Significant Year: 1906
Historic Function: Commerce, Trade
Historic Sub-Function: Financial institution
Current Function: Government
Current Sub-Function: City Hall
